I have a 1983 Mercruiser 3.0 and I am installing an electric fuel pump on. I have read all the installation theads and I know you are supposed to wire it to the oil pressure switch. My engine does not have a pressure switch on it (i think). I do have a oil pressure sending unit but I beleive the two are different. Is there any way to get around this as I have checked every local parts store/marine store and none of them have one(so the say). Can I just wire to the alternator?? Re: 1983 Mercruiser 3.0 Fuel Pump

1. Why are you going to an electric fuel pump? The mechanical last longer, and are cheaper.

2. You MUST use a marine rated electric fuel pump, and you will need to tee in an oil pressure switch with your oil pressure sender, and basically wire it like this. The hookup to the starter is so the fuel pump runs while you are cranking the engine to start it.
